Industry News: Solenoid Coil Degradation and Electrical Failures Impacts Surface Mining Operations Reliability

Cummins diesel fuel injectors, specifically model 4397488 and related part number 4397588, continue to present maintenance challenges in heavy-duty Surface Mining Operations operations worldwide. According to recent service data, solenoid coil degradation and electrical failures remains one of the most frequently encountered reliability issues affecting injector performance.

The electronic solenoid coil that controls injector timing degrades over time from thermal cycling, vibration, and contamination. This causes electrical resistance drift and intermittent connection failures.

Service technicians report that 4397488 injectors typically develop this condition after 14547 operating hours, with erratic injector timing variation, inconsistent fuel delivery, and engine hesitation during acceleration being the most common complaints. In severe cases, 41% electrical resistance deviation has been measured during diagnostic testing.
